SENATE RESOLUTION NO. 1133 WHEREAS, The Senate of the State of Texas is pleased to recognize Lydia G. Sandoval on the occasion of her 25th anniversary at Lone Star National Bank in McAllen; and WHEREAS, Lydia Sandoval began her career at Lone Star National Bank as a new accounts representative; by dint of her talent and hard work, she has risen through the ranks to become vice president and branch sales manager; and WHEREAS, She has overcome the obstacles historically faced by women and minorities in the banking and finance industries to attain her current position, and in so doing has become a role model and inspiration to all those who wish to enter these competitive fields; and WHEREAS, Appreciated and admired by colleagues and customers alike, she treats each client with respect and professionalism, providing them with expert counsel on their financial needs and offering them the guidance they require to ensure that their families' needs are met; and WHEREAS, Her wonderful loving family has played an important role in her success throughout her career, as she and her husband, Rudolfo, have lived the lessons learned from their parents and passed this valuable legacy on to their children, Rudy and Erica; Mrs. Sandoval is truly deserving of recognition for her many years of dedication, hard work, and outstanding service; now, therefore, be it RESOLVED, That the Senate of the State of Texas, 82nd Legislature, hereby commend Lydia G. Sandoval on 25 years of exceptional service to Lone Star National Bank of McAllen and extend to her best wishes for continued success in all her future endeavors; and, be it further RESOLVED, That a copy of this Resolution be prepared for her as an expression of high regard from the Texas Senate.
